THE AGENCY Creative Artists Agency (CAA) is the leading entertainment and sports agency, with global expertise in filmed and live entertainment, digital media, publishing, sponsorship sales and endorsements, media finance, consumer investing, fashion, trademark licensing, and philanthropy. Distinguished by its culture of collaboration and exceptional client service, CAA’s diverse workforce identifies, innovates, and amplifies opportunities for the people and organisations that shape culture and inspire the world.

As the Senior Finance Analyst, you will report directly into the Financial Controller and play a key role in supporting the finance activities for the continually growing Sports department. The role has a wide range of responsibilities and will require someone who can work accurately and to tight deadlines. Teamwork will be essential, and an inclusive attitude is required.

R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Work alongside the Revenue Accountant in preparing and distributing revenue invoices
  • Review of revenue contracts for invoicing and financial reporting considerations
  • Credit control (including timeous invoicing and follow-up of outstanding amounts)
  • Maintenance of the debtors ageing report, including working with the systems team to improve this report
  • Key person in preparation of balance sheet reconciliations
  • Preparation of month end journals
  • Preparation of month end flux analysis, particularly on debtors’ recovery
  • Monitor the Booking Report (revenue related) email address alongside the revenue accountant and timeous processing of new deals onto revenue trackers
  • Process and control implementation
  • Documenting process notes for all relevant processes
  • Support the business partner in preparing budget and reforecast tasks
  • Ensuring timeliness, accuracy and completeness of transaction processing into the financial system- Microsoft Dynamics 365 and revenue trackers
  • Liaising with project managers to ensure project budgets are up to date
  • Perform calculations, analyses and reports as requested by the Financial Controller or Finance Director (UK & International)
  • Play a supporting role in the annual statutory audits by preparing documentation and supporting schedules
  • Support the Financial Controller or Finance Director (UK & International) in ad-hoc projects / tasks.
QUALIFICATIONS/REQUIREMENTS
  • Qualified accountant (ACA/ACCA/CIMA) or equivalent, ideally with a minimum of 5 years of relevant experience.
  • Must be comfortable with multi-tasking.
  • Should ideally be passionate about Sports.
  • Must have a high level of attention to detail and great organisational skills.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ills are essential as the role involves dealing with both internal and external stakeholders.
  • Ability to be a team player with a conscientious and motivated attitude.
  • Strong knowledge of Excel e.g. V look ups and Pivots.
  • Experience in Microsoft Dynamics 365 desirable.
